The statement actually applies to the text by revealing that one is in a place where what he needs is available but he is lamenting and regretting for not getting what he wants.
The statement was taken from "A Piece of Chalk".
"A Piece of Chalk" is a known to be classic writing of G.K. Chesterton. It actually portrays the importance and interest people have in small things.
From the given statement, the speaker reveals that one is in a desert place (Sahara) where there is sand and still regrets and complains of no sand in his hour-glass.
This depicts that one has what he needs but still complains of want.
